How to check iPhone charging cycles and battery health using Battery Life.
Step 1: Launch the Battery Life app successfully installed on your device.
Step 2: Immediately on the program interface, the application will assess the battery health of the device.
Here, select the Menu section with the icon of 3 horizontal dashes at the top left of the screen.
Step 3: Choose the Battery Information section to view details about our iPhone's battery.
Step 4: In the Battery Information section, the screen will provide us with the following information:
Battery Level: Remaining battery level in the current device.
Capacity: Total battery capacity you will use when the device is fully charged. (To put it simply, subtract the initial displayed battery drain percentage from 100% battery capacity)
Voltage: Indicates the voltage level the device is using.
Charging Cycle: Number of times the battery has been charged.
Temperature: Current temperature of the device.

Additionally, we can employ some tricks to extend the lifespan of our iPhone battery such as using Low Power Mode, monitoring power-hungry apps, reducing screen brightness, disabling unnecessary connections, all are ways to prolong the iPhone battery lifespan. Or, utilize some battery-saving tricks for iPhone like: Turning off AirDrop, Disabling stock notifications, Turning off Bluetooth, location services, Turning off automatic updates for new apps on iTunes & Appstore, Disabling Siri when not needed. These are ways to help us save iPhone battery during usage, for longer and more efficient usage.
